Definitions:

Corrective Action

Measures taken to identify, eliminate, and prevent recurrence of defects or problems in a process or system.

Referent Power

A form of influence based on the charisma and interpersonal attraction of the leader, leading others to identify with them.

Personal Power

The influence and authority an individual possesses within an organization or group, derived from personal attributes or relationships rather than formal positions.

Legitimate Power

The authority granted to individuals in leadership positions as a part of their role, allowing them to influence others.
